Learning Objectives
The case allows students to learn about the complexity of sustainable entrepreneurship, especially the existence of intractable tensions. Students will assess the individual and organization-level trade-offs that might be necessary to create system-level change. After working through the case and assignment questions, students will be able to
- understand that sustainability tensions occur across the individual, organizational, and systemic and industry levels;
- analyze a business situation to identify the tensions and the levels at which they occur;
- assess an organization’s financials as part of making recommendations for how to manage such tensions; and
- make integrated decisions about how an organization can maximize its ability to accomplish its social mission.
